Преглед изворни кода

fix:语言导致的结构切换问题&属性导入Excel示例

ananzhusen пре 3 месеци
родитељ
комит
e8e3e36733
2 измењених фајлова са 8 додато и 8 уклоњено
  1. 6 6
      src/views/components/Data.vue
  2. 2 2
      src/views/components/Structure.vue

+ 6 - 6
src/views/components/Data.vue

@@ -377,7 +377,7 @@
       </div>
     </div>
   </div>
-  <div class="content" v-if="group === $t('解析')">
+  <div class="content" v-if="group === '解析'">
     <div class="flex between">
       <div class="title">{{$t('数据')}}{{ group }}</div>
     </div>
@@ -796,23 +796,23 @@ const onOkAddData = () => {
 const importDataset = async () => {
   let columns: any = [
     {
-      header: $t('设备'),
+      header: '设备',
       key: 'device',
     },
     {
-      header: $t('显示名称'),
+      header: '显示名称',
       key: 'label',
     },
     {
-      header: $t('属性名'),
+      header: '属性名',
       key: 'id',
     },
     {
-      header: $t('类型'),
+      header:'类型',
       key: 'type',
     },
     {
-      header: $t('值范围'),
+      header: '值范围',
       key: 'mock',
     },
   ];

+ 2 - 2
src/views/components/Structure.vue

@@ -1,5 +1,5 @@
 <template>
-  <div class="elements props" :v-show="'group' === $t('图层')">
+  <div class="elements props" v-show="group === '图层'">
     <div class="flex mt-16 mb-16" style="justify-content: end; padding-right: 8px">
       <t-tooltip placement="top" :content="$t('置顶')">
         <div class="icon-box" @click="changeActivLayer('top')">
@@ -119,7 +119,7 @@
       </template>
     </t-tree>
   </div>
-  <div class="elements" :v-show="'group' === $t('分组')">
+  <div class="elements" v-show="group=== '分组'">
     <div class="groups-panel" style="padding: 8px 0">
       <div class="flex middle between" style="padding: 0 12px">
         <div class="title">{{$t('分组')}}</div>